diff options
author | Uoti Urpala <uau@mplayer2.org> | 2011-09-03 13:47:56 +0300 |
---|---|---|
committer | Uoti Urpala <uau@mplayer2.org> | 2011-09-03 14:26:14 +0300 |
commit | 83fc5b60046b12227540f77969b5c1aa29107bad (patch) | |
tree | f72bbea73524a7b9005e3c935fafe1f20bd43991 /mplayer.c | |
parent | 3e0a2705595cbf991e0428984052488ad94c6d21 (diff) | |
download | mpv-83fc5b60046b12227540f77969b5c1aa29107bad.tar.bz2 mpv-83fc5b60046b12227540f77969b5c1aa29107bad.tar.xz |
options: move libass-related options to struct
Diffstat (limited to 'mplayer.c')
-rw-r--r-- | mplayer.c | 6 |
1 files changed, 3 insertions, 3 deletions
@@ -1134,7 +1134,7 @@ void add_subtitles(struct MPContext *mpctx, char *filename, float fps, if (!asst) { subd = sub_read_file(filename, fps, &mpctx->opts); if (subd) { - asst = mp_ass_read_subdata(mpctx->ass_library, subd, fps); + asst = mp_ass_read_subdata(mpctx->ass_library, opts, subd, fps); sub_free(subd); subd = NULL; } @@ -4178,7 +4178,7 @@ int main(int argc, char *argv[]) #endif #ifdef CONFIG_ASS - mpctx->ass_library = mp_ass_init(); + mpctx->ass_library = mp_ass_init(opts); mpctx->osd->ass_library = mpctx->ass_library; #endif @@ -4688,7 +4688,7 @@ goto_enable_cache: struct demuxer *d = mpctx->sources[j].demuxer; for (int i = 0; i < d->num_attachments; i++) { struct demux_attachment *att = d->attachments + i; - if (use_embedded_fonts && attachment_is_font(att)) + if (opts->use_embedded_fonts && attachment_is_font(att)) ass_add_font(mpctx->ass_library, att->name, att->data, att->data_size); } |